  [Impact]
  The latin keyboard map lacks functionality to do dead_hook and dead_horn 
characters, which makes it inconvenient to type Vietnamese characters.
  
  [Development Fix]
  Patch from reporter was accepted upstream, and included in precise as a 
cherrypick of what went up.
  
  [Stable Fix]
  We're carrying the same xkeyboard-config in both quantal and precise 
currently, so can carry the same patch both places.
  
  [Test Case]
- 1.  Set keyboard map to latin
- 2.  Type the 3rd and 4th level on the j key
+ 1.  In System Settings, go to Keyboard Layout
+ 2.  Select Layouts
+ 3.  Press the '+' to add a layout
+ 4.  Type 'Maori' (or other layout that imports Latin)
+ 5.  In Options, make sure you have 'Key to choose 3rd level' selected (e.g. 
set to Right Windows key)
+ 6.  Hold your configured 3rd level key (e.g. Right Windows key)
+ 7.  Press j
  
  Broken Behavior:  No character printed
  Fixed Behavior:  3rd level places a hook under characters, 4th puts a horn on 
top.
  
  [Regression Potential]
  None expected, this adds functionality to previously unused keys.
  
  Possibly some people have locally mapped j to other key behaviors, but
  seems unlikely, and they can just as easily locally re-map it again if
  they prefer.
  
  [Original Report]
  Because I occasionally type in Vietnamese, but not with sufficient frequency 
to learn a completely different keyboard layout, I find it most useful to add 
dead_hook and dead_horn to the latin keyboard layout (as imported from the 
Maori layout). I had thought this a minor enough issue to just leave the patch 
on my own system but it got overwritten last time I did a distribution upgrade.
  The added deadkeys are on level 3 and 4 of the J key, which were previously 
unused.
